Rep. Blumenauer Bill Will Help Drive Clean Energy Job Growth
EDF Statement of Elizabeth Gore, Senior Vice President, Political Affairs
“Putting people back to work must be a top priority for Congress, and reducing obstacles to renewed economic prosperity is an essential part of the recovery. It is imperative that Congress include direct pay as part of the full suite of solutions we need to rebuild a stronger and cleaner economy. By enabling direct payments of existing tax credits for renewable energy projects, this bill will give developers the resources they need to continue projects already underway, and drive momentum for future growth.”
“Representative Earl Blumenauer’s Renewable Energy and Investment Act will help ensure the American renewable energy industry regains the momentum it experienced before the start of the pandemic. EDF commends Rep. Blumenauer for his leadership in advancing incentives and investment in renewable energy.”
- Elizabeth Gore, Senior Vice President, Political Affairs
